Mattia is 13 years old and the other morning he was going to school by bicycle, as he does every morning when the weather is nice and it starts to get hot. He had left shortly after 7 from Marentino (province of Turin) and he pedaled quickly towards Andezeno where there is the middle school he attends. In a downhill stretch from the side of the road between the grass and the bush they jumped out two large boars that overwhelmed him. Mattia fell off his bicycle doing a flight of 4 meters: "He was afraid that they would attack him, he wanted to escape but because of his injuries he could not get up - says his father Cristian Boniscontro, municipal councilor in Marentino - Luckily they escaped».
They were terrible moments: "A car arrived, a Red Cross volunteer was driving who helped my son - continues Boniscontro - He was taken to hospital, the prognosis is 15 days: he has six deep abrasions and a wound on his arm which required 5 stitches ». The incident brings to the fore the problem of wild boars, the subject of protests by farmers also on Sunday at the Giro d'Italia. «The plan of the Metropolitan City has proved a failure - thunders the mayor of Marentino Bruno Corniglia - The hunters have their hands tied and the wild boars destroy all crops. In addition to creating security problems ». Coldiretti also points the finger at the Metropolitan City strategy: "The area of the accident - says Fabrizio Galliati, president of Coldiretti Turin - is part of the repopulation and capture areas, areas closed to hunting that have the purpose of favoring the production of sedentary wildlife, to favor the stop and reproduction of migrants. These areas have now totally lost the sense for which they were designed. In the document that established that of Marentino, the aim was to favor the reaffirmation of the hare and partridge, while today they have become safe areas for the proliferation of the wild boar that has occupied and devastated everything "(The print).
